2012-02-10 12 views
0

enter image description here觸摸序列密碼

我想製作一個密碼序列爲我的應用程序..like,在點的保護.. 我想知道我一定要學會整個的Open GL ES爲it..or它可以與(void) touchesMoved完成,然後檢查每個按鈕處於CGrectIntersects() ..

我想到的是給CGrectInterscts嘗試......但之後,我看到那個點保護應用技術,不知何故沒有按't 讓用戶從1移至2(請參閱scren拍攝。)。

我認爲這種類型的複雜機制......是不能用這種方式完成的。 任何關於如何進行的幫助將不勝感激。

enter image description here

回答

0

我認爲這是絕對的東西,你可以用touchesmoved實現! 我自己做了這樣的事情,我認爲你應該完全按照你所說的去做,只需跟着touchesbegan(和touchesmoved和touchesended)跟蹤每個動作,然後用你的uiimageviews或座標來使用CGRectIntersect,但是你想要做到這一點。這是可能的!

+0

你是如何在上面的截圖中阻止移動形式1到2的? – Shubhank 2012-02-10 13:02:50

+0

好吧,你可能保存所有已經觸及的點,所以當CGRectintersect返回true時,只需檢查點是否是相鄰的點,不應該太難:) – 2012-02-10 13:09:06

+0

好的..謝謝..我會嘗試它今晚..將在那之後接受.. – Shubhank 2012-02-10 13:26:59